//=============================================================================
//
// CLASS Plane3D
//
//=============================================================================
#ifndef OPENMESH_PLANE3D_HH
#define OPENMESH_PLANE3D_HH
//== INCLUDES =================================================================
#include <OpenMesh/Core/Geometry/VectorT.hh>
//== FORWARDDECLARATIONS ======================================================
//== NAMESPACES ===============================================================
namespace OpenMesh {
namespace VDPM {
//== CLASS DEFINITION =========================================================
/** \class Plane3d Plane3d.hh <OpenMesh/Tools/VDPM/Plane3d.hh>
ax + by + cz + d = 0
*/
class Plane3d
{
public:
typedef OpenMesh::Vec3f vector_type;
typedef vector_type::value_type value_type;
public:
Plane3d()
: d_(0)
{ }
Plane3d(const vector_type &_dir, const vector_type &_pnt)
: n_(_dir), d_(0)
{
n_.normalize();
d_ = -dot(n_,_pnt);
}
value_type signed_distance(const OpenMesh::Vec3f &_p)
{
return dot(n_ , _p) + d_;
}
// back compatibility
value_type singed_distance(const OpenMesh::Vec3f &point)
{ return signed_distance( point ); }
public:
vector_type n_;
value_type d_;
};
//=============================================================================
} // namespace VDPM
} // namespace OpenMesh
//=============================================================================
#endif // OPENMESH_PLANE3D_HH defined
